Not only was it acceptable for a lover to serve his young boyfriend as a patron; it was positively expected. The more honoured a citizen, and the better connected, the more effectively he could further his beloved’s career. Elite would advance elite: so it was that a boy, yielding to the nocturnal thrustings of a battle-scarred older man, might well find the secret well-springs of Spartan power opened up to him.
